Hospitality

To qualify under this category, an applicant must:

Hold a valid Temporary Work Permit for one of the following occupations;

  • Food/Beverage Server (NOC 6453)
  • Food Counter Attendant/Kitchen Helper (NOC 6641)
  • Housekeeping/Cleaning Staff (6661)

An applicant must:

  • Have been employed by a Saskatchewan employer in one of those positions for a minimum of six months and have a permanent job offer from original employer in Canada.
  • Be employed in Saskatchewan for a minimum of six months and meet or exceed all employer established work and performance standards
  • Must have arrived from outside of Canada and employer have an approved settle
  • ment plan by Saskatchewan Immigration prior to arriving to start work

  • Have completed a minimum of Grade 12 education (or equivalent); and
  • Have a minimum of CLB 4 or higher English Language ability across all 4 categories (listening, speaking, reading, writing) for continued employment in Saskatchewan
